Elite Gourmet Food Dehydrator, Adjustable Temperature Controls

Material : Plastic

|

Power : 350 watts

|

Temperature Range : 95°F to 158°F

|

Heating System : Convection

|

Weight : 5.3 pounds

|

Temperature Control : Yes

|

Capacity : 5 trays

|

Dimensions : 12.4 x 11.7 x 11.6 inches

|

Timer : No

|

Airflow : Vertical

About Elite Gourmet Food Dehydrator, Adjustable Temperature Controls
84% were impressed with the temperature range, whereas 16% weren't
My only complaint is that the temperature selection is a series of ranges, but I knew that before purchasing it, so it's not a big issue.
I noticed that the dehydrator was not reaching the temperature at the numbers I set it at. I cranked it all the way up and it got about 20 degrees hotter than the dial claims is the max temp.
The highest setting of the dehydrator is 140-158 F, but it couldn't maintain the temperature above 125 F even after several hours with meat in it. Anything lower than 140 F allows dangerous bacterial growth.
83% appreciated the temperature control , yet 17% didn't
Using a dehydrator is more energy efficient and reliable with temperature controls than using an oven.
I am impressed with the temperature control of this dehydrator. It has two tray height settings and maintains a consistent temperature throughout the cycle. I even checked the temperature with an infrared thermometer.
I had to crank up the temperature to get the desired numbers and it exceeded the max temperature by 20 degrees.
71% liked the size and design, but 29% desired more
The trays have large spacing and anything small falls right through, making it less than ideal for drying small beans, berries or fruit pieces.
70% highlighted the silent operation
I found the dehydrator to be quiet. I used it to dehydrate some bananas after doing the initial cleaning.
75% liked the capacity
I was able to dehydrate the jerky to my preferred moisture content of 6% without any issues, indicating the dehydrator has good capacity.
I can easily fit two 1 Kg filament spools by cutting out the centers of trays, except for the bottom one.
70% found the airflow system helpful, while 30% encountered issues
After using the dehydrator for a few hours, I noticed a significant reduction in stringing of PLA and PETG filament and oozing from the printer nozzle.
I have compared this dehydrator with others I have used over the years and found that it has two tray height settings and spot-on temperature control.
Even after several hours with meat in it, the temperature did not go higher than 125 F. This may be due to the dehydrator's airflow system.
